## Formula sandbox tuning

User-supplied formulas in Gridmoor execute inside a restricted interpreter with hard ceilings on time, memory, and call depth. Reviewers should confirm any change to these ceilings is justified in the PR description, since raising them widens the abuse surface. Defaults were chosen from production traces. The current limits are as follows.

limits module of tafog-fawip:
WEIGHTS = {
    "julix": 57,
    "lamys": 992,
    "kasvan": 209,
    "quenok": 750,
    "alddor": 259,
    "oliath": 1009,
    "wenix": 815,
}

Quarterly Planning Note — Headcount

Welcome aboard. Next year's plan for the Stellwick unit adds eleven roles: seven in product engineering, two in support, two in finance. Hiring is front-loaded into the first half, contingent on the Pindrel renewal closing. Attrition is modeled at 8%. You will own requisition approvals from February. The strategic backdrop for these numbers is captured in the confidential note below.

board note of bawep-tajef: Queniusek Systems plans to raise the Quenvan list price by 53.1 percent in March. The pricing group signed off on a budget of $176.4 million for Project Drueth. The renewal with Casionix Partners closes at $142.5 million a year, 8.3 percent below the last contract. Project Fraax slips by six weeks because of the tooling delay.

## Further Reading

This section collects background for the migration off Corkboard, our homegrown job queue, onto the new Relayline service. The design doc covers delivery guarantees, the dual-write cutover plan, and rollback criteria. Benchmarks comparing throughput under backlog conditions were presented at last month's review. Decisions and open questions are tracked for the weekly eng sync on the internal page below.

operations page: https://jenkins.zemvarcloud.local/job/merge_requests/repo/build/73930b4b30f0a8ed

## Sensor drift — Verdella greenhouse controller

Plugin authors: humidity probes drift roughly 2% per month. Verdella recalibrates nightly against the reference node; never apply your own offsets, or corrections stack. Read calibrated values only from the telemetry bus. Your plugin must authenticate to the bus at startup, and the credential for that is set on the following line.

sealed setting: COURIER_KEY29=170ad45524657711572101e080d15